Summary : Provides oversight of the activities on a nursing unit during a specific shift including serving as a resource to staff, directing patient flow, precepting or mentoring staff, assuring appropriate utilization of resources, and providing oversight for the provision of quality care in a manner satisfying to patients.

Responsibilities :

  • Evaluates one's own nursing practice in relation to professional practice standards and relevant statues and regulations, identifying short and long-term professional goals.
  • Maintains current knowledge, serves as a resource on departmental policies, procedures and processes, and assists in assuring compliance.
  • Assists in finding creative solutions to issues and contributes knowledge to process and quality improvement.
  • Utilizes the ANA scope and standards practice and the code of ethics for nurses with interpretive statements as the foundation of nursing practice.
  • Mentors other in areas such as competency, documentation, equipment use, plan of care, National Patient Safety Goals and participation in in-service education
  • Exhibits a general understanding of the process for dealing with ethical dilemmas, understand, and coordinates the process for obtaining an ethics consult.
  • Coordinates patient flow on the unit to facility the provision of timely and effective care
  • Expedites admission process for ready beds when assigned
  • Provides and ensures quality patient care
  • Communicates effectively with patients and families to resolve issues and provides service recovery when needed.
  • Participates in daily rounds and other patient satisfaction activities. Performs routine environment of care rounds and facilitates resolution of issues.
  • Assures patient privacy is protected and confidentiality of information is maintained on the unit. Participates on a hospital or departmental level committee as requested
  • Assists in assuring appropriate utilization of supplies and equipment, maintenance of supply levels and are of equipment and facilities.
  • Assures appropriate utilization of staff on unit by preparing staff schedules, overseeing staffing for shift and making patient assignments to meet patient needs in an efficient and cost effective manner
  • Regularly attends hospital wide bed meetings
  • Assists with hiring, orientating, precepting, coaching and evaluating staff Evaluates care given by staff
  • Coaches to improve care Establishes effective work relationships with staff and supports action plans in meeting staff satisfaction goals.
  • Understands, articulates, supports and serves as a resource for the components of the nursing bundle. Including observation and coaching of staff. Maintains professional, effective and timely communication with physicians, other departments, (fast track) patients and families, staff, EMS partners and community members.
  • Provides departmental leadership in the absence of the unit director / manager / supervisor. Meets or exceeds productivity standards Assures patient flow is efficient.
  • Distributes staff resources to meet patient occupancy Role model for teamwork, fills beds, cleans beds, assists others with their assignment, facilitates admissions, recognizes when staff members are overwhelmed and adjusts assignment according; balances assignments, delegates appropriately.
  • Assists in providing positive impressions to patients and visitors, promotes a caring and compassionate approach to all interactions.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.

  • MINIMUM EDUCATION QUALIFICATION

    An Associate's Degree in Nursing. Equivalent knowledge, experience, education, or training may be substituted for education.

    MINIMUM EXPERIENCE QUALIFICATION

    1-year nursing experience in area of specialty or previous charge nurse or supervisory experience

    MINIMUM CERTIFICATION QUALIFICATION

    Current registered nurse license in the State of Alaska.

    Current Basic Life Support card required.

    All other certifications as required for specific work area : New Employees must obtain the required Certifications within six months of hire; Contract and MOA employees must come to us with the required training completed as outlined in their individual contracts / MOAs, and must be licensed as a registered nurse by the State of Alaska and remain active with all annual licensing requirements.

    PREFERRED EDUCATION QUALIFICATION

    Bachelor's degree in nursing preferred

    PREFERRED EXPERIENCE QUALIFICATION

    N / A

    PREFERRED CERTIFICATION QUALIFICATION

    Specialty certification applicable to

    ADDITIONAL REQUIREMENTS

    Must have participated in 30 hours every 2 years continuing education in nursing in general, 16 of which are in the specific area of practice. Successful completion of Charge RN training program within 3 months of promotion to charge RN Successful completion of preceptor training program within 3 months of promotion to charge RN

    May be required to work outside the traditional work schedule.

    May be called out to work off-shift in emergency situations.
